wdwflash 06-18-2002 12:49 PM

Well, my first car show was kind of disapponting. It was the first time they had this car show, so I don't think they really had it down. No awards for, imports, sports cars, kit cars, etc.(they didn't really know what to make of my car with a rotary engine.) They did have an award for "Euro Car" that went to a riced out Honda(I think it was a honda.) There were about a half dozen imports there(out of 100-125 cars.)
